The Trinamool Congress (TMC) will meet the Election Commission today to discuss the contentious Special Intensive Revision (SIR) of the voter list in Bihar. The delegation will express their concerns about the SIR and other issues. Election Commission officials have stated the need for the revision due to ineligible individuals obtaining voter IDs. Opposition parties have raised concerns that this revision might affect the rights of legitimate voters. The Election Commission is preparing to undertake an intensive review of voter lists in six states, starting with Bihar, to identify and remove foreign illegal immigrants. This is happening while considering upcoming elections in Bihar and other states.
